Contemplative wisdom practices have their origins in the ancient world and come down to us through various traditions such as The Rule of St. Benedict, the wisdom teachings of Jesus, and the Fourth Way work of G.I. Gurdjief. Cynthia Bourgeault says that wisdom work "comes from above ground at times when the planet is going through changes or when consciousness is about to take a major leap to a new place, a new level of understanding."
